So often I hear from people wanting to get into the offshore drilling industry, and most have no skills or anything else to offer. Yes there are opportunities to get into the drilling industry however you need to plan for this.
I am also a Rig Electrician and so I am going to do my best to give you all the information you require to get into the oil industry, some of you will and some will not, it will all depend on your qualifications, experience and being in the right place and at the right time. Good electrical people are hard to find and like many older hands I started my career in the merchant marine and transferred, these days getting good experience is harder, so good industrial electrical experience is necessary.
I have worked in the offshore oil industry for more than 25 years and I am going to make an effort and hand over to you a little no sugar coating ideas on work in the oil industry. If you already work in the offshore oil industry or you are attempting to get yourself a new situation offshore this site will try and impart you uncomplicated, hard-nosed and unbiased tips.
You should to distinctly understand that it is not as effortless and unproblematic as some oil rig employment websites would have you believe. You simply can not walk onto an offshore installation into a new vacancy without some fundamentals in place.
Offshore installations are potentially dangerous places, and safety and safe working practices is what we all live and breathe. For many openings it most without doubt is not a training ground for somebody who doesn't have fundamental safety training or skills. Read the book on offshore safety.
In general workers with a pertinent trade in mechanical or electrical or electronics discipline have the best probability at getting a technical appointment start, however experienced hands is what most companies chase, and that's utterly sensible. The offshore universe isn't a charity industry, contractors expend big dollars and if you want big riches you got to help the company make them.
It is up to you to exhibit yourself in the most outstanding way possible to prospective employers and give companies a rationale to start you off. The oil field is not for sissies!
